The range is divided in to two distinct model variants. The XR series are optimised for road use, while the XC models thrive in more rugged terrain, but both are equally happy when the roles are reversed. The unique-in-class 1215cc triple engine delivers more power, more torque and improved fuel consumption, smoothly and progressively across the whole rev range. TRIUMPH SEMI ACTIVE SUSPENSION (TSAS) The new Tiger Explorer s performance is given a new level of dynamism on the XCx,XCA,XRx & XRt models with the addition of the ground-breaking Triumph Semi Active Suspension System. This allows the rider to electronically control the adjustment of the front and rear suspension damping, automatically adapting the rear shock absorber pre-load settings to reflect the terrain being covered and load carried, to provide optimal grip and drive in any situation. The system uses an inertial measurement unit which incorporates 3 gyros and 3 accelerometers to continuously measure the bike's roll, pitch and yaw as well as longitudinal & lateral accelerations. The chassis central unit then uses this information, along with suspension position, swing arm position, wheel speed sensors, brake pressure and twist grip, to calculate the damping settings. All designed to deliver an engaged, confidence inspiring ride. RIDER MODES The new Tiger Explorer family makes full use of Triumph s impressive Rider Mode technology to offer a choice of up to five Rider Modes, four which are pre-set and one which can be programmed by the rider which alters the configuration of the bike to suit riding style, road and weather conditions. Each Rider Mode changes the engine map, the levels of ABS and Traction Control, and where fitted, the damping set-up of the TSAS system and power. Rider Modes: ROAD Maximises comfort and riding pleasure, particularly over long distances. The ABS and Traction Control settings ensure great stability and optimise braking on paved surfaces. The engine map is set to make the most of the smooth delivery of power over asphalt or similar surfaces. The TSAS (if fitted) will provide the optimal setting for road use.
